What is a Mesothelioma Lawsuit?

A mesothelioma lawsuit is a legal claim an asbestos victim or his family file to seek financial compensation against negligent asbestos manufacturers. Mesothelioma patients seek compensation for medical costs loss of income, living expenses.

Legal proceedings can be complicated and time-consuming but with the right law firm in your corner you will receive an appropriate amount of compensation for your claims.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er will assist you in identifying asbestos manufacturers responsible for your exposure and decide the best method to pursue the lawsuit.

After a mesothelioma suit has been filed, the lawyers of both sides will work together to gather evidence and reach an agreement. If a settlement is not reached, the case could be tried in front of a jury or judge. On average, more than 95% of mesothelioma cases reach settlements.

People who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or asbestosis, or any other asbestos-related illness, may file a lawsuit for personal injury or wrongful death against the asbestos company(s) accountable for their exposure. A court-appointed estate representative or a family member of a loved one may file a lawsuit on behalf of a mesothelioma sufferer.

Millions of dollars have been recovered in settlements by victims through lawsuits against asbestos producers. However, these settlements may not suffice to cover all of your losses. Your lawyer must prove that your mesothelioma or asbestos-related illness is directly connected to exposure to asbestos so that you can get the compensation you are entitled to.

The statute of limitations, which determines how long you can bring a lawsuit, varies according to the state. Contacting a qualified lawyer immediately is essential to find out how much time remains to make an action.

Many asbestos producers have set up trust funds to pay for those injured by their products. A mesothelioma attorney can help you determine if a firm has set up a trust fund and guide you through the claim process. On average, mesothelioma sufferers receive $1 million or more in settlements. How long will a mesothelioma lawsuit take?

A lawsuit can take a long time dependent on the state law and complexity of the case. However, mesothelioma lawyers can help clients speed up the process of litigation with expedited court procedures and by submitting medical documents to demonstrate the existence of a terminal illness or other unique circumstances.

A successful claim for mesothelioma requires evidence of the fact that asbestos exposure caused the condition. Documentation of the type of exposure, the location and detailed exposure histories are essential. In addition to collecting this information, lawyers must identify the responsible parties for the victim's illness and submit claims to them. This process may be long but it's vital to ensure that claimants receive the maximum amount of compensation.

Asbestos patients must also be prepared for a trial which could add to the stress of dealing with an already serious illness. Mesothelioma trials can take months or years to complete. Mesothelioma lawyers may reduce the duration of the trial by having video depositions. These are recordings of in-person or virtual interviews that can be used in trial.

In many cases, a mesothelioma lawsuit will settle before it reaches the trial stage. A skilled mesothelioma lawyer can negotiate a fair settlement that is based on the impact of the disease on the victim and their family's financial security.

The most significant factor in determining the value of a mesothelioma claim is the nature and severity of the cancer as well as a patient's age at the time of diagnosis. Lawyers can make use of life expectancy calculations to determine the length of time a person is entitled to compensation.

Once a fair settlement offer is in place A mesothelioma lawyer can give advice on whether to take the offer or continue seeking a verdict at trial. A jury or judge will decide the final compensation amount, which may be more than a settlement however is not guaranteed.

Can a family member File a Mesothelioma Lawsuit?

When a mesothelioma victim dies, their loved ones may be eligible to file a wrongful death lawsuit. This type of claim may help families obtain compensation for financial losses caused by the loss of a family member. Family members may also be able to receive compensation for physical and emotional trauma due to the loss of loved ones.

Mesothelioma lawyers can assist families of victims with filing asbestos-related wrongful death claims. Lawyers can make sure that all paperwork is filed in a correct manner and on time. They can also help families find reputable mesothelioma attorneys to collaborate with.

Family members can be able to receive compensation for funeral expenses, medical expenses, other mesothelioma related expenses and other mesothelioma-related expenses and. Settlements for wrongful deaths are usually substantial. This is because mesothelioma may be a very painful and aggressive disease. It can take a heavy toll on a person's life, both financially and emotionally.

State laws differ in regards to who is able to bring a suit for wrongful death against mesothelioma patients. In the majority of states, however only immediate family members of the victim (such as their spouses and children), can file a lawsuit. In certain instances life partners and certain non-family members may also be eligible to pursue a claim of wrongful death.

A mesothelioma lawyer can determine whether the estate's representatives are qualified to file a wrongful death lawsuit on behalf of the deceased. They can then begin an investigation to find out more about the various asbestos-related products that the victim was exposed to and the manufacturers who were responsible.

Once the mesothelioma lawyer has completed their investigation and has filed an action for wrongful death on the victim's behalf. The asbestos companies will have the chance to respond to the claim, either by settling on an agreement or denying the claim and beginning the trial.
